What is the Hourly Rate and Billing Process of a Divorce Lawyer?
A divorce lawyer hourly rate typically ranges from $200 to $600+ per hour, and most cases start with a retainer of about $2,500 to $10,000. Billing is usually tracked in 0.1–0.25 hour increments for calls, emails, and court work, with monthly invoices showing time entries and costs. How Does Filing for Bankruptcy Affect My Credit Score?
Filing for bankruptcy typically drops your credit score by 130–240 points and remains on your credit report for 7–10 years (Chapter 13 vs. Chapter 7). The impact depends on your starting score, debt history, and post-filing credit behavior. This article explains the credit effects, bankruptcy types, timelines, and recovery steps. Are There Mandatory DUI Classes or Programs in California?
Yes—California typically requires a state-licensed DUI program after a DUI conviction, commonly 3 months for a first offense and up to 30 months for repeat offenses. The exact length depends on your case factors and court/DMV orders, and completion is often required to keep or reinstate driving privileges.
